Mein B-day Kalender^^

09.09.2008 16:36 (zuletzt bearbeitet: 09.09.2008 16:45)
avatar  Mikke
#1 Mein B-day Kalender^^
Mi
Mitglied
Hey .. hab mir en script für en B-day Kalender
rausgewühlt .... jetzt will ich den so verändern
das diese dämliche bemerkung nimmer angezeigt wird ^^

evtl. kann mir einer mit Java kenntnissen helfen :)

<table border=0 align=center cellPadding=0 cellSpacing=7 bgcolor=FFFFAA>
<tr>
<td align=center>

<script type="text/javascript">
<!--
// Das Script stammt von W. Zenk
// eMail: webmaster@homepage-total.de
// Homepage: http://www.homepage-total.de
// Das Script darf frei genutzt werden,
// solange dieser Vermerk nicht entfernt wird!

var Schriftfarbe = "#0000FF"; // Schriftfarbe ändern
Name = new Array; GeburtsTag = new Array;
GeburtsMonat = new Array; GeburtsJahr = new Array;
Bemerkung = new Array; var n = 1;


Name[n]="Damiana"; GeburtsTag[n]=17; GeburtsMonat[n]=01; GeburtsJahr[n]=1971; Bemerkung[n]="" ; n++;
Name[n]="Name"; GeburtsTag[n]=9; GeburtsMonat[n]=9; GeburtsJahr[n]=1989; Bemerkung[n]="" ; n++;
Name[n]="Name"; GeburtsTag[n]=25; GeburtsMonat[n]=9; GeburtsJahr[n]=1977; n++;

// Ab hier erweiterbar (Jede Zeile einen Geburtstag eintragen. Geburtstag, Monat und Jahr müssen immer angegeben werden!)


Monate = new Array("Januar","Februar","März","April","Mai","Juni","Juli","August","September","Oktober","November","Dezember");
var t = 0, Geburtstage = n-1;
var HeutigesDatum = new Date();
var Tag = HeutigesDatum.getDate();
var Monat = HeutigesDatum.getMonth()+1;
var Jahr = HeutigesDatum.getFullYear();

document.writeln('<font size=2><big><b>Geburtstage im ' + Monate[Monat-1] + ':');
document.writeln('</b></big></font><br><br> <font color='+Schriftfarbe+'>');

for (i = 1; i <= Geburtstage; i++) {
if (GeburtsMonat[i] == Monat) {
var Alter = Jahr - GeburtsJahr[i];
document.writeln("<b>"+Name[i] + "</b> (" + Alter + ")<br>" + "Geburtstag: ");
if (GeburtsTag[i] == Tag) {
document.writeln("(heute) ");
}
document.writeln(GeburtsTag[i] + "." + GeburtsMonat[i] + "." + Jahr + "<br><i>" +Bemerkung[i]+"</i><br><br>");



t++;
}
}

if (t==0) {
document.writeln('Keinen Eintrag gefunden!');
}


//-->
</script>

</td>
</tr>
</table>


Ich entferne die rot markierten stellen
das müsste doch eigentlich reichen oder ?


und wenn einer weiss wie ich die bdays
nebeneinander anzeigen lassen kann wär wär auch nett und von vorteil :)


Disskutiere nicht mit Idioten. Sie ziehen dich runter auf ihr Niveau und schlagen dich dort mit Erfahrung

MissYs World - Kunst & More


 Antworten

 Beitrag melden
09.09.2008 18:32 (zuletzt bearbeitet: 09.09.2008 18:33)
avatar  Ben
#2 RE: Mein B-day Kalender^^
avatar
Ben
Mitglied
Hallo,also Bemerkung[n]="" ; solltest eigentlich drinn lassen,wenn du keine Bemerkung reinsetzen möchtest,
das lass es halt leer.Wenn du "Bemerkung[n]="" ;" rausnimmst,kommt dann der Begriff "undefiniert".

Die Bemerkung ist da,um z.B. "Bemerkung[n]="Alles gute!" ;" reinzuschreiben.


Und das + "<br><i>" +Bemerkung[i]+"</i><br><br>" muß auch drin bleiben.

 Antworten

 Beitrag melden
09.09.2008 19:21
avatar  Mikke
#3 RE: Mein B-day Kalender^^
Mi
Mitglied

Also das das teilweise drin bleiben muss hab ich schon gemerkt ...^^

wenn ich einfach nichts schreibe ist mir die lücke zum 2ten b-day zu gross :(

hab die bemerkung jetzt schon draussen gehabt so zwischendurch ...
nur dann fehlt mir der umbruch zum 2ten bday

document.writeln(GeburtsTag[i] + "." + GeburtsMonat[i] + "." + GeburtsJahr[i] ); t++;



und wenn ich das <br><br>" drinn lass also so:

document.writeln
(GeburtsTag[i] + "." + GeburtsMonat[i] + "." + GeburtsJahr[i]+ " +<br><br>); t++;


dann ist da en fehler drin



Disskutiere nicht mit Idioten. Sie ziehen dich runter auf ihr Niveau und schlagen dich dort mit Erfahrung

MissYs World - Kunst & More


 Antworten

 Beitrag melden
10.09.2008 20:29 (zuletzt bearbeitet: 10.09.2008 20:52)
avatar  Mikke
#4 RE: Mein B-day Kalender^^
Mi
Mitglied
Hier der richtige Code :)

 document.writeln(GeburtsTag[i] + "." + GeburtsMonat[i] + "." + GeburtsJahr[i] + " <br><br>"); t++;


und hier im ganzen "GeburtstagsKalender ohne Bemerkung"
der nur für registrierte user Sichtbar ist :)
den angezeigten Geburtstag hab ich auch aufs geburtsjahr geändert :)

{{user_registered==true.start}}
<hr>
<table border=0 align=center cellPadding=0 cellSpacing=7 bgcolor=#000000>
<tr>
<td align=center>

<script type="text/javascript">
<!--
// Das Script stammt von W. Zenk
// eMail: webmaster@homepage-total.de
// Homepage: http://www.homepage-total.de
// Das Script darf frei genutzt werden,
// solange dieser Vermerk nicht entfernt wird!

var Schriftfarbe = "#CD0000"; // Schriftfarbe ändern
Name = new Array; GeburtsTag = new Array;
GeburtsMonat = new Array; GeburtsJahr = new Array;
Bemerkung = new Array; var n = 1;


Name[n]="Damiana"; GeburtsTag[n]=17; GeburtsMonat[n]=01; GeburtsJahr[n]=1971; n++;
Name[n]="Name"; GeburtsTag[n]=10; GeburtsMonat[n]=9; GeburtsJahr[n]=1989; n++;
Name[n]="Name"; GeburtsTag[n]=25; GeburtsMonat[n]=9; GeburtsJahr[n]=1977; n++;

// Ab hier erweiterbar (Jede Zeile einen Geburtstag eintragen. Geburtstag, Monat und Jahr müssen immer angegeben werden!)


Monate = new Array("Januar","Februar","März","April","Mai","Juni","Juli","August","September","Oktober","November","Dezember");
var t = 0, Geburtstage = n-1;
var HeutigesDatum = new Date();
var Tag = HeutigesDatum.getDate();
var Monat = HeutigesDatum.getMonth()+1;
var Jahr = HeutigesDatum.getFullYear();

document.writeln('<font size=2><big><b>Geburtstage im ' + Monate[Monat-1] + ':');
document.writeln('</b></big></font><br><br> <font color='+Schriftfarbe+'>');


for (i = 1; i <= Geburtstage; i++) {
if (GeburtsMonat[i] == Monat) {
var Alter = Jahr - GeburtsJahr[i];
document.writeln("<b>"+Name[i] + "</b> (" + Alter + ")<br>" + "Geburtstag: ");
if (GeburtsTag[i] == Tag) {document.writeln("(heute) ");}


document.writeln(GeburtsTag[i] + "." + GeburtsMonat[i] + "." + GeburtsJahr[i] + " <br><br>"); t++;
}
}

if (t==0) {
document.writeln('Keinen Eintrag gefunden!');
}


//-->
</script>

</td>
</tr>
</table>

<hr>
{{user_registered==true.end}}


die rot markierte class (oder wie man das bei javascripten nennt)
muss leider stehen bleiben ...
warum auch immer .. aber sonst hat man en fehler drin :)

vlt. kann fabian mir ja doch nomma sagen warum xD


Disskutiere nicht mit Idioten. Sie ziehen dich runter auf ihr Niveau und schlagen dich dort mit Erfahrung

MissYs World - Kunst & More


 Antworten

 Beitrag melden
28.09.2008 20:19
#5 RE: Mein B-day Kalender^^
da
Mitglied

Hallo Mikke,

wo soll ich denn den Geburtstagskalender einfügen im Forum.

Danke!

Viele Grüße

daschu77

Mein Homepagemodules Forum unter:
http://90533.homepagemodules.de

Die neuesten Beiträge im meinem Forum:


 Antworten

 Beitrag melden
28.09.2008 21:22
avatar  Mikke
#6 RE: Mein B-day Kalender^^
Mi
Mitglied

im Prinzip wo du möchtest ....

meiner ist unten in der Forums Übersicht ..
zwischen Statistik und dem restlichem Forum ....



Disskutiere nicht mit Idioten. Sie ziehen dich runter auf ihr Niveau und schlagen dich dort mit Erfahrung

MissYs World - Kunst & More


 Antworten

 Beitrag melden
03.10.2008 15:02
#7 RE: Mein B-day Kalender^^
da
Mitglied

Hallo Mikke,

kannst mal Deine Forum URL hier posten.

Danke!

daschu77

Mein Homepagemodules Forum unter:
http://90533.homepagemodules.de

Die neuesten Beiträge im meinem Forum:


 Antworten

 Beitrag melden
04.10.2008 00:42
avatar  Mikke
#8 RE: Mein B-day Kalender^^
Mi
Mitglied

daschu

in meiner signatur ;)

Aber Ich poste sie auch gerne nochmal so

http://164060.homepagemodules.de

aber wenn du den Kalender sehen willst ... musst du dich anmelden ;)



Disskutiere nicht mit Idioten. Sie ziehen dich runter auf ihr Niveau und schlagen dich dort mit Erfahrung

MissYs World - Kunst & More


 Antworten

 Beitrag melden
08.09.2009 23:19
avatar  Sakisa
#9 RE: Mein B-day Kalender^^
Sa
Mitglied

Hi,

ich schließe mich hier mal an, weil ich auch gerne ein Geburtstagskalender ins Forum einstellen möchte.....ich habe "Euren" Kalender mal in mein Versuchsboard eingebaut...nur, man kann den Kalender auch sehen, wenn man nicht eingeloggt ist --- was habe ich da falsch gemacht??????

Wäre nett, wenn Ihr mir einen Tipp geben würdet! DANKE im voraus!!

LG

Sabrina

Versuchsborad: http://160754.homepagemodules.de/


 Antworten

 Beitrag melden
Bereits Mitglied?
Jetzt anmelden!
Mitglied werden?
Jetzt registrieren!